我有一个http流链接,它给我的.flv流饲料。我想转换它并在我的iPhone程序中访问。我该怎么做呢?我想有一个桌面软件,如VLC和输入这个流式饲料网址,并转换为iPhone支持,再次流到iPhone。我尝试了VLC与H.264和Mpeg-1音频,但似乎它没有给出支持的格式,所以iPhone程序不能播放视频。有人可以指导我如何设置一个桌面软件,可以流iPhone支持的文件?
提前谢谢。
发布于 2011-01-15 06:05:52
我认为即使是伟大的VLC也不能在运行中转换FLV…(甚至不能用FLV做任何事情)。就流媒体而言,你可能会被限制在本地网络(Wi-Fi)。我会从简单的方法开始-在桌面上创建一个临时文件服务器,然后使用AVPlayer的initWithURL方法来查找视频。
在桌面上,您可以查询计算机的IP地址,并要求用户在iDevice上输入该地址(以及可选的端口分配和文件组件,如http://192.168.0.2:2234/streamingVideo.mp4),然后转换为NSURL。
发布于 2011-04-20 09:34:05
http流链接到底是什么?这很重要,因为为了流式传输到iPhone,你需要使用HTTP Live Streaming,它需要一些不同于典型的flash媒体,或者更确切地说,RTMP服务器的比特。通常情况下,您需要两种不同的流媒体架构或一些昂贵的盒子。
https://stackoverflow.com/questions/4696211
复制相似问题